- FHFA House Price Index values in ZIP 53532 (Deforest, WI) rose +5.3% from 2023 to 2024. The all-transactions index moved from 238.4 in 2023 to 251.1 in 2024 (2000 = 100).
ZIP code 53532 is a mid-sized community (a standard USPS delivery area) in Deforest, Dane County, Wisconsin, home to 13,606 residents across 140.1 square miles, a density of 97 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 53532 skews affluent, with a median household income of $110,022 (41% above the average Wisconsin ZIP), while per-capita income is $51,761. Both reported hardship measures are comparatively low in absolute terms: poverty is 5.0% and unemployment is 2.0%. Housing is both higher-cost and owner-heavy: median home value is $371,600 (49% above the average Wisconsin ZIP), while 80.9% of occupied homes are owner-occupied and median rent is $1,414.
A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 42.7%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 40.2, and the average commute is 25 minutes. Home values in ZIP 53532 have increased 5.3%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+151% cumulative appreciation.
| Year | Annual Change | HPI Index |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| +2.8% | 174 |
| 2021 | +10.6% | 193 |
| 2022 | +13.7% | 219 |
| 2023 | +8.9% | 238 |
| 2024 | +5.3% | 251 |
Source: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index, All-Transactions, Five-Digit ZIP Codes (Developmental Index). Index base = 100 in year 2000. Data through 2024. ZIP codes with few transactions may show missing values.

Census Bureau data shows 353 business establishments in ZIP 53532, employing approximately 7,516 people with a combined annual payroll of $521,386,000.
